Fantastic Voyage: Storyboard/narrative Revised
Going back to my narrative I have decided to make this animation based on ferns after forest fires and how it can life back to an environment these are called bracken ferns. So I have changed the colours to represent the changes in environment.
The major differences is the narrator (the silhouette's hands at the beginning) is shown in the beginning scene talking about the forest fires and he blows the fire out to then follow the ashes from the flame into the scene. The fern that is shown in the early scenes will be changed to covered in ashes to represent its fight for survival with a lonely leaf sticking out of the pile.
The rest of the animation will stay pretty much the same apart from the ending with the ferns growing back from the ground to then zoom out to reveal a landscape full of ferns and giving life back to the environment. I want the narrator to end the scene as well. Therefore I will zoom far out to reveal a landscape and his hand come over as it goes from a burnt landscape to a green luscious landscape with him talking about how it brought life back to the earth.
Although this is quite rough it gives me an idea for a script and this now allows me to start production in Maya, a few scenes need a bit of work to how they are going to look in terms of colour as im not sure on the purple of the spores and how the sperms are going to look too.

I was looking at how objects are represented in the three brothers and I may just silhouette the spore and the sperm with a strong light source behind them and use a morphing method for the close up of the spore into a gametophyte and then the style will change when the environment changes at the end into a more magical environment. Sound Scape: Storyboard
In my scene I wanted to focus on one of the characters on the top of the image and to show them traveling through the image as if they were there, so I used the character that looks like an animal and behaves similar to a cat, likes to explore and escape mischief.
It's all about him travelling through the tree lines at first and he gets interrupted by some strange sounds he then jumps onto the ground where he see's the horror of the creatures and what they are doing, so he decides to flee up onto the archway/bridge. He then proceeds to find the imp ontop of the bridge, and decides to look over at the scene from above, this is when we reveal the overall image at the very end.
If it were to go onto animation, I think I would keep the creature a sillouette and play around with the shadows with him blending into the shadows as he goes through the trees. Now onto the animatic :)
